Process to Connect Your SteelSeries To Your Engine

Below are different methods to connect the SteelSeries products with your Windows or Mac PCs.

Method 1: Connect The Devices Wirelessly

If you are using a wireless product and want to connect it to your computer, then follow the steps given below.

For Windows Users:

Step1: Click on the Windows icon present on the taskbar to open the Start menu.

Step2: Search Settings in the searchbar and hit the Enter key.

Step3: Go to the Devices section.

Step4: Choose the Bluetooth tab from the left panel. Then, click on the Bluetooth & other devices option. Also, turn on the Bluetooth toggle switch.

Step5: If your Bluetooth device is not visible on your PC, select the More Bluetooth options.

Step6: This will open a new window for Bluetooth Settings. Over there, select the Options tab.

Step7: Then, navigate your way to the Discovery section. Select the Allow Bluetooth devices to find this PC option.

Step8: Click on the Apply button to save the settings.

For Mac Users:

Step1: Press and hold the Pairing button on your SteelSeries wireless device.

Step2: Click on the Apple logo present in the top-left corner of your screen.

Step3: Choose the System Preferences option from the dropdown menu.

Step4: Go with the Bluetooth option in the System Preferences’ context menu list.

Step5: Wait till your SteelSeries device’s name appears on the list. Then, click on the Connect button to establish the connection.

Method 2: Connect The Devices Using A Wire

If you have a wired SteelSeries device that you wish to connect with either your Windows or Mac PC, then you just need to insert the cable in its dedicated port, and hopefully, your computer will recognize the device and start using it. However, if in case your computer is unable to connect to the device, try to check for any broken or tired cables or loose connections. If everything looks fine but still the device doesn’t work, update your device drivers.

Pro Tip: Fix Connection Problems with Your SteelSeries Products

The most common reason why you are unable to connect your SteelSeries device to your PC is the outdated drivers. The best way to keep all your drivers up to date is either by updating your Windows OS or using the Device Manager tool. But if you use the Device Manager tool, you need to update every driver manually one by one. Therefore, to update all the drivers at the same time you should go for the Windows update as it will update the drivers along with it. Below are some steps that will help you with the process.

Step1: Click on the Windows icon present on the taskbar to open the Start menu.

Step2: Type Settings in the searchbar of the Start menu and hit the Enter button on your keyboard.

Step3: On the Settings window, go to the Update & Security section.

Step4: Select the Windows Update tab from the left pane.

Step5: Then on the right panel, click on the Check for Updates button. This will allow your computer to search online for any newer versions of your operating system.

Step6: If there is any version available, the Download and Install Now button will appear on your screen. Click on that button to start downloading the new Windows OS.

Step7: To install the new OS, follow the instructions given in the wizard window.

Step8: After installing the operating system, restart your computer and it might some time to implement the changes. Now, this process will automatically, update all the device drivers along with the OS.
